Output 81cafbe59753bcbcc5a1c560aa6c77d95b23755f88ccc1ed43c2358cfb73bb69:0

value
26562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79be4322e1f92b0514e8f97bba1aa92d59b07099 OP_EQUAL
address
3CnjcQdQhMSASLWszHjxHGRxApAcCMi8MK
transaction
81cafbe59753bcbcc5a1c560aa6c77d95b23755f88ccc1ed43c2358cfb73bb69